Skip to content

Commit e7a7a8d

Browse files
Merge pull request #2129 from chiragkyal/custom-host
OCPBUGS-34373: Bump library-go to fix routes/custom-host permission for externalCertificate
2 parents d831e17 + 1140fa4 commit e7a7a8d

File tree

28 files changed

+49
-117
lines changed

28 files changed

+49
-117
lines changed

go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-51,7 +51,7 @@ require (
5151
github.com/openshift/api v0.0.0-20241001152557-e415140e5d5f
5252
github.com/openshift/apiserver-library-go v0.0.0-20241001175710-6064b62894a6
5353
github.com/openshift/client-go v0.0.0-20241001162912-da6d55e4611f
54-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c
54+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060
5555
github.com/pkg/errors v0.9.1
5656
github.com/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2
5757
github.com/prometheus/client_golang v1.19.1

go.sum

+2-2
Original file line numberDiff line numberDiff line change
@@ -506,8 +506,8 @@ github.com/openshift/client-go v0.0.0-20241001162912-da6d55e4611f h1:FRc0bVNWpri
506506
github.com/openshift/client-go v0.0.0-20241001162912-da6d55e4611f/go.mod h1:KiZi2mJRH1TOJ3FtBDYS6YvUL30s/iIXaGSUrSa36mo=
507507
github.com/openshift/google-cadvisor v0.49.0-openshift-4.17-2 h1:ls1C5cvJbA5CbOwbA4Nx/W+tRvXgKDc9XT81bg3sxCA=
508508
github.com/openshift/google-cadvisor v0.49.0-openshift-4.17-2/go.mod h1:s6Fqwb2KiWG6leCegVhw4KW40tf9f7m+SF1aXiE8Wsk=
509-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c h1:QXYkFJn7wLTHAI56l+9DJnLrNynGtXjyOZLgiIglTnE=
510-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c/go.mod h1:9B1MYPoLtP9tqjWxcbUNVpwxy68zOH/3EIP6c31dAM0=
509+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060 h1:jiDC7d8d+jmjv2WfiMY0+Uf55q11MGyYkGGqXnfqWTU=
510+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060/go.mod h1:9B1MYPoLtP9tqjWxcbUNVpwxy68zOH/3EIP6c31dAM0=
511511
github.com/openshift/onsi-ginkgo/v2 v2.6.1-0.20240806135314-3946b2b7b2a8 h1:HJvLw9nNfoqCs16h505eP8E1kVmq6KNdzGm5csPlYsQ=
512512
github.com/openshift/onsi-ginkgo/v2 v2.6.1-0.20240806135314-3946b2b7b2a8/go.mod h1:rlwLi9PilAFJ8jCg9UE1QP6VBpd6/xj3SRC0d6TU0To=
513513
github.com/opentracing/opentracing-go v1.1.0/go.mod h1:UkNAQd3GIcIGf0SeVgPpRdFStlNbqXla1AfSYxPUl2o=

openshift-kube-apiserver/admission/route/hostassignment/admission.go

-5
Original file line numberDiff line numberDiff line change
@@ -136,11 +136,6 @@ func (a *hostAssignment) Admit(ctx context.Context, attributes admission.Attribu
136136
return errors.NewInvalid(attributes.GetKind().GroupKind(), attributes.GetName(), errs)
137137
}
138138

139-
errs = hostassignment.ValidateHostExternalCertificate(ctx, r, old, a.sarClient, a.validationOpts)
140-
if len(errs) > 0 {
141-
return errors.NewInvalid(attributes.GetKind().GroupKind(), attributes.GetName(), errs)
142-
}
143-
144139
errs = hostassignment.ValidateHostUpdate(ctx, r, old, a.sarClient, a.validationOpts)
145140
if len(errs) > 0 {
146141
return errors.NewInvalid(attributes.GetKind().GroupKind(), attributes.GetName(), errs)

staging/src/k8s.io/api/go.sum

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/apiextensions-apiserver/go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-78,7 +78,7 @@ require (
7878
github.com/modern-go/reflect2 v1.0.2 // indirect
7979
github.com/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 // indirect
8080
github.com/mxk/go-flowrate v0.0.0-20140419014527-cca7078d478f // indirect
81-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c // indirect
81+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060 // indirect
8282
github.com/pkg/errors v0.9.1 // indirect
8383
github.com/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
8484
github.com/prometheus/client_golang v1.19.1 // indirect

staging/src/k8s.io/apiextensions-apiserver/go.sum

+2-2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/apiserver/go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 require (
2020
github.com/grpc-ecosystem/go-grpc-prometheus v1.2.0
2121
github.com/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822
2222
github.com/mxk/go-flowrate v0.0.0-20140419014527-cca7078d478f
23-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c
23+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060
2424
github.com/spf13/pflag v1.0.5
2525
github.com/stretchr/testify v1.9.0
2626
go.etcd.io/etcd/api/v3 v3.5.14

staging/src/k8s.io/apiserver/go.sum

+2-2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/cloud-provider/go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-60,7 +60,7 @@ require (
6060
github.com/modern-go/concurrent v0.0.0-20180306012644-bacd9c7ef1dd // indirect
6161
github.com/modern-go/reflect2 v1.0.2 // indirect
6262
github.com/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 // indirect
63-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c // indirect
63+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060 // indirect
6464
github.com/pkg/errors v0.9.1 // indirect
6565
github.com/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
6666
github.com/prometheus/client_golang v1.19.1 // indirect

staging/src/k8s.io/cloud-provider/go.sum

+2-2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/component-base/go.sum

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/component-helpers/go.sum

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/controller-manager/go.sum

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/dynamic-resource-allocation/go.sum

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/kube-aggregator/go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-65,7 +65,7 @@ require (
6565
github.com/modern-go/concurrent v0.0.0-20180306012644-bacd9c7ef1dd // indirect
6666
github.com/modern-go/reflect2 v1.0.2 // indirect
6767
github.com/mxk/go-flowrate v0.0.0-20140419014527-cca7078d478f // indirect
68-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c // indirect
68+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060 // indirect
6969
github.com/pkg/errors v0.9.1 // indirect
7070
github.com/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
7171
github.com/prometheus/client_golang v1.19.1 // indirect

staging/src/k8s.io/kube-aggregator/go.sum

+2-2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/kube-controller-manager/go.sum

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/kubelet/go.sum

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/pod-security-admission/go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-58,7 +58,7 @@ require (
5858
github.com/modern-go/reflect2 v1.0.2 // indirect
5959
github.com/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 // indirect
6060
github.com/onsi/gomega v1.33.1 // indirect
61-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c // indirect
61+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060 // indirect
6262
github.com/pkg/errors v0.9.1 // indirect
6363
github.com/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
6464
github.com/prometheus/client_golang v1.19.1 // indirect

staging/src/k8s.io/pod-security-admission/go.sum

+2-2
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

staging/src/k8s.io/sample-apiserver/go.mod

+1-1
Original file line numberDiff line numberDiff line change
@@ -55,7 +55,7 @@ require (
5555
github.com/modern-go/concurrent v0.0.0-20180306012644-bacd9c7ef1dd // indirect
5656
github.com/modern-go/reflect2 v1.0.2 // indirect
5757
github.com/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822 // indirect
58-
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241001171606-756adf2188fc // indirect
58+
github.com/openshift/library-go v0.0.0-20241107160307-0064ad7bd060 // indirect
5959
github.com/pkg/errors v0.9.1 // indirect
6060
github.com/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
6161
github.com/prometheus/client_golang v1.19.1 // indirect

0 commit comments

Comments
 (0)